Materials Used

[0086]3GT-1: A 3GT homopolymer available commercially under the tradename SORONA from DuPont.[0087]I-1: an ethylene / methacrylic acid dipolymer (15 weight % MAA), neutralized with Na+ (59%), MI of 0.9 g / 10 min.[0088]I-2: an ethylene / methacrylic acid dipolymer (15 weight % MAA), neutralized with Zn+2 (58%), MI of 0.7 g / 10 min.[0089]I-3: an ethylene / methacrylic acid dipolymer (19 weight % MAA), neutralized with 2.5 weight% Mg(OH)2, MI of 1.1 g / 10 min.[0090]EMA-1: an ethylene / methyl acrylate dipolymer (30 weight % MA), MI of 3 g / 10 min.[0091]Nuc-1: sodium montanate obtained from Clariant under the tradename LICOMONT NaV101.[0092]AO-1: bis-(2,4-di-t-butylphenyl) pentaerythritol diphosphite antioxidant from GE Specialty Chemicals under the tradename ULTRANOX 626.[0093]Wax: processing wax available commercially as AC Wax 16A, Honeywell, Morristown, N.J.).

Abstract

Disclosed is a composition comprising or produced from poly(trimethylene terephthalate), an ionomer of an ethylene acid copolymer comprising copolymerized units of at least one α,β-ethylenically unsaturated carboxylic acid comonomer, a nucleating agent and optionally an ethylene ester copolymer. Also disclosed are articles prepared from the composition. Also disclosed is a process for preparing the compositions, including methods for controlling the melt viscosity and strain hardening of the compositions.

Description

[0001]This application claims priority to U.S. provisional application Ser. No. 61 / 023220, filed Jan. 24, 2008; the entire disclosure of which is incorporated herein by reference.[0002]The invention relates to nucleated poly(trimethylene terephthalate) compositions, and methods for controlling their melt viscosity and elevated temperature stress-strain properties.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0003]Thermoplastic polymers are commonly used to manufacture various shaped articles that may be used in applications such as automotive parts, food containers, signs, and packaging materials. Shaped articles comprising polyester may be prepared from the molten polymer by a number of melt extrusion processes known in the art, such as injection molding, compression molding, blow molding, and profile extrusion.[0004]Shaped articles may also be produced by thermoforming in which a thermoplastic film or sheet is heated above its softening temperature and formed into a desired shape.
